The Beach is a location in the northernmost part of Rapoville in Drawn to Life and Drawn to Life: The Next Chapter, the westernmost part of Rapoville in Drawn to Life: The Next Chapter (Wii), and the southwesternmost part of Rapoville in Drawn to Life: Two Realms.
It is where the Lighthouse can be seen, and where Pirate Beard's ship comes to dock in the port when it first arrives. The villagers come there to play often after the Hero retrieves the Beach Toys Template, as beforehand they said it was too empty and boring. Throughout the series, many adventurous characters can be found here.
Story[edit]
Before Drawn to Life[edit]
Before the events of Drawn to Life, the Creator had gifted the village the Lighthosue to help ships navigate into the Docks unharmed. Shortly before the Darkness overtook the beach, a ship began approaching the Docks, but was overtaken by the Darkness.
Drawn to Life[edit]
The beach is first mentioned after Deadwood's defeat. Mayor asks the Creator to clear the Darkness in the northern part of the village, revealing the beach and the Beach Gate to the player. When the Hero tries to enter the gate, they are stopped by Samuel, who gives the player a page from the Book of Life containing the Flippers. Equipped with the Flippers, the Hero returns to the beach to find Mari and Jowee finding a message in a bottle. When they pull the paper out, they realize that they had found the Starzooka page from the Book of Life.
After creating the Starzooka, Mayor and the Hero start receiving complaints from the villagers, saying that the beach was too boring, so the Hero goes to Surf Beach to find a Template page for Beach Toys. The Hero returns with the template and Crazy Barks's crew. They are met by Heather, who sends them to Mayor, who welcomes them back to the village. The Creator then makes the Beach Toys, placing them near the water. This prompts most of the village to go play on the beach, leaving the Hero to find Mari. However, the beach was too crowded for her, so she heads to the Secret Beach nearby.
On a mission for Kori Trees, the Hero rescues Bubba and his caretakers, reuniting them with Tubba at the Beach Gate. Tubba and Bubba then move into a house just south of the beach together. Later, Mari asks the Hero to find Jowee and invite him to the Secret Beach. The Hero finds him on the beach, digging for treasure with Heather. Jowee then leaves for the Secret Beach, leaving Heather to keep digging on the beach alone. However, she follows him in secret.
After finding the template for the Epic Statue in Angle Isle, the Hero returns Indee and his family to the village, meeting with Jowee at the Beach Gate. Jowee is starstruck, and later joins Indee on the beach to get some pointers on treasure hunting. Indee asks the Hero to clear the Darkness from the eastern half of the beach, revealing the Boat House, the Docks, the abandoned ship, and an uncolored Lighthouse.
The Hero travels through the Conch Ruins to find the template for the Lighthouse, and discovers Pirate Beard and his crew along the way. When returning them to the village, the Mayor decides to give them the ship at the Docks in exchange for not plundering the village. The Creator restores the Lighthouse, allowing the ship to sail into the Docks, but this reveals the Angler King lurking nearby. Before being able to enter the Beach Gate to fight the Angler King, the Hero is stopped by Wilfre, who asks the Hero why they continue to help the Raposa. However, the Hero pushes past him and enters the gate. After the Angler King's defeat, the Hero returns to the village with Count Choco and the template for the Kaorin Bushes.
Much later, after the Mayor's death and Wilfre's defeat, Jowee decides to go on an adventure with Pirate Beard. Mari and Jowee say goodbye at the Docks, and Mari leaves to reminisce on her life. She watches the ship leave the village, but is shocked to see that Jowee decided to stay behind with her.

Drawn to Life: The Next Chapter[edit]
The beach is only seen during the beginning of the game, when Pirate Beard, Crazy Barks, Mike, Isaac, Cindi, Mari, and Jowee attempt to escape Rapoville before all of the Color is drained. Pirate Beard plans on using his ship, but learns that it had been stolen, so the Creator sends Turtle Rock to pick the villagers up.
Drawn to Life: Two Realms[edit]
Four years later, Pirate Beard, Indee, and Unagi plan on going on an adventure but are too lazy to get any planning done. Mari sends the Hero to go help them using the Book of Imagination, and they successfully invigorate them. Pirate Beard then asks the Hero to go visit NavyJ, who was planning on having a concert, but getting stage fright. After Aldark's defeat, the three Raposa set sail on their adventure.
